Dynamodb Bulk Insert Boto3, In order to improve performance with A tu


  • Dynamodb Bulk Insert Boto3, In order to improve performance with A tutorial that shows how to insert multiple records programmatically and delete items by conditions using Python and Boto3 library This article will detail how many records you can insert in a single batch write operation using DynamoDB and Boto3, along with technical explanations, examples, and additional subtopics to give Batch-write data into DynamoDB to improve performance and reduce costs. batch_get_item(**kwargs) ¶ The BatchGetItem operation returns the attributes of one or more items from one or more tables. batch_writer() , the boto3 API , does it insert or it updates as well? By Update i mean the partition key, sort key are same , but other attributes are not same. We also covered advanced capabilities like こんにちは。AWS CLIが好きな福島です。 今回は、AWS SDK for Python (Boto3)を使って、DynamoDBを操作してみたいと思います。 参考情 This cheat sheet covers the most important DynamoDB Boto3 query examples that you can use for your next DynamoDB Python project. Table('name') Parameters: name (string) – The Table’s name identifier. It’s atomic, meaning either all updates This method creates a context manager for writing objects to Amazon DynamoDB in batch. I would like to do the same for updates i. How to import data directly from Amazon S3 into DynamoDB, and do more with the data you already have. Boto3 ライブラリは, ライブラリの 3 番目のメジャーバージョンであり、2015 年に初めてリリースされました。 Boto3 ライブラリは、DynamoDB だけでなくすべての AWS サービスをサポートするた Ten practical examples of using Python and Boto3 to get data out of a DynamoDB table. This cheat sheet covers the most important DynamoDB Boto3 query examples that you can use for your next DynamoDB Python project. The batch writer handles chunking up the items into batches, retrying, etc. Basics are code examples that show you Causes DynamoDB to evaluate the value before attempting a conditional operation: If Exists is true, DynamoDB will check to see if that attribute value already exists in the table. 33 to run the dynamodb batch-write-item command. ConditionalCheckFailedException exception is throw which has Select your cookie preferences We use essential cookies and similar tools that are necessary to provide our site and services. Batch Writing Data Now, instead of writing records one-by-one, which can be slow and inefficient, we'll use DynamoDB's batch_writer() to A tutorial that shows how to insert multiple records programmatically and delete items by conditions using Python and Boto3 library In this blog, we will learn how to put items into DynamoDB table using python and boto3. AWS Data Pipeline – You We would like to show you a description here but the site won’t allow us. then, we can directly use boto3-dynamodb-resource to put python representation of an entry into This article will provide the reader with a step-by-step guide on how to create a dynamodb table, batch write items to the table, and how to We would like to show you a description here but the site won’t allow us. Table (TableName) table. If you have not subscribed Numbers are sent across the network to DynamoDB as strings, to maximize compatibility across languages and libraries. PythonでDynamoDBを操作するにはboto3というライブラリを使用します。 複数の登録または削除のリクエストをするにはbatch_writerを使用します。 アイテムを登録する場合はput_ How to add items and scan DynamoDB with boto3 3. We will use the AWS SDK, Boto3 to deploy our resources for this project programmatically. The only data types allowed are number, number set, string set or binary set. batch_write_item (). You create the batch writer as a context manager, Learn about the different abstraction layers, configuration management, error handling, controlling retry policies, managing keep-alive, and more. I I m very new to DynamoDB, I want to do upload data (file. This is a step by step guide with code. e. DynamoDB / Client / batch_get_item batch_get_item ¶ DynamoDB. resource('dynamodb') table = dynamodb. It’s often referred to as a key-value Causes DynamoDB to evaluate the value before attempting a conditional operation: If Exists is true, DynamoDB will check to see if that attribute value already exists in the table. When using Boto3 to interact with DynamoDB, one key feature このような状況において、効率的に大量データを登録するために有効な方法が、Pythonスクリプトを使ったDynamoDBへの一括登録です。 Use the AWS CLI 2. resource ('dynamodb') table = dynamodb. Learn how to work with these and basic CRUD operations to start We have explored how to add data to Amazon DynamoDB using Boto3 library in Python which started with the basics of properly installing There are a few ways to bulk insert data into DynamoDB tables using the AWS JavaScript SDK.

    dwnaovmd
    hgock
    go4cr
    3a8wcv4
    8aofpbbo
    peugbmb
    k7kb3re3
    lphke
    bk0coo
    qdaixpgd